Caroline Hirons knows skin. An established industry expert and aesthetician, she knows what works, what doesn't, what you need and what you absolutely do not.

Whether you are a skincare pro or overwhelmed by information, Skincare: The New Edit covers where to start, how to build a routine, ingredients to look for and things to avoid, whatever your age, skin concerns or budget.

Fully revised and updated, this book is packed with all the latest skincare recommendations, brands

and techniques... and no nonsense. Including:

  • Brand new photography
  • All new product recommendations
  • Industry updates
  • Fully restructured for maximum usability
  • New sections on black skin, SPF, maskne, perimenopause and menopause
